Hello there, @Dan Winkler ! Knowing who is the Space admin is in Confluence is an important part of the usage.
If you access the Space settings and then go to the overview, you will see the “Created by” and the “Administrators” list as well.
Here is how to reach this information:
- Go to the desired space
- Click Space Settings
- Select Overview
- Click the Space Details tab
